What makes us so special?

  • We set up the senior playgroup in 2004 and pride ourselves on our warm, friendly, home-from-home atmosphere We have a very low turnover of staff and this allows relationships to be built between children and staff and provides a continuity of care
  • Our staff are well qualified, experienced and we maintain high standards by continuing with our in-house training on a regular basis.
  • We have three beautiful spacious, bright, well equipped & maintained rooms, in the town’s original station
  • We are registered & monitored by Social Services.
  • We are also inspected by the ETI (Education Training Inspectorate). Please don’t be afraid to ask for our latest social services inspection report as we take great pride in maintaining the highest standards.
  • We also provide well balanced, nutritional meals and snacks (morning & afternoon) that are prepared on-site by our cook, Sylvia, using fresh produce from the local butchers and greengrocer
  • We maintain a close open partnership with our parents – ensuring that we offer feedback and support to families through newsletters and the My Nursery Pal app
  • We offer a drop-off & pickups service to the two local schools, Dromore Central & St. Colman’s.
  • We also offer wraparound care for parents who need it
